Добавление классов к абзацам для стилизации

Привет,

Я пытаюсь создать несколько пользовательских стилей абзацев с помощью CSS.

p.custom-class {
  font-size: 30px;
  line-height: 40px;
  direction: rtl;
}

Однако, когда я применяю этот класс в редакторе Discourse, он не работает:
<p class="custom-class">ТЕКСТ</p>

Мне нужно создать несколько стилей абзацев. Нужна помощь в решении этой проблемы. Есть какие-то решения?

Спасибо.

Редактирование: Похоже, что div[data-theme-*] работает, но для элемента p это не срабатывает.

Возможно, посмотрите Обобщённый обёртка bbcode для компонентов темы